Latest Patents

Hooper holds a patent for an "Apparatus for preventing the transmission of vibrations." This invention includes a first and second frame with a rod attached to one of the frames, allowing for slideable movement. The apparatus features an air bag or other force transmitting mechanism that is connected to one frame and abuts the other. A fluid source is utilized to push the frames apart, while a biasing structure ensures they move closer together when fluid escapes. Additionally, the design incorporates a valve structure for controlling fluid flow, enhancing the apparatus's functionality.
